Output 6ee06081a03e9012ec5974011d786afa69cd6b008b142a2116ddefc8efa05f8b:1

value
291180487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af95aef565cc3e75e6de1cc1ff7b35c436a371c OP_EQUAL
address
3EMqtX8rHtwVouZBsZDuKkbY91nKYQNkn8
transaction
6ee06081a03e9012ec5974011d786afa69cd6b008b142a2116ddefc8efa05f8b
confirmations
299158
spent
true